Comprehensive Coverage of the PE Civil Exam Transportation Depth Section
The Transportation Depth Reference Manual for the PE Civil Exam prepares you for the transportation depth section of the NCEES PE Civil Transportation Exam. It provides a concise, yet thorough review of the transportation depth section exam topics and associated equations. More than 25 end-of chapter problems and 45 example problems, all with step-by-step solutions, show how to apply concepts and solve exam-like problems. A thorough index directs you to more than 280 equations, 150 tables, 140 figures, 35 appendices, and to the exam-adopted codes and standards.

Norman R. Voigt, PE, PLS is registered as both a civil engineer and land surveyor in Pennsylvania. He holds a Bachelor of Science and master’s degree in civil engineering from the University of Pittsburgh. He has been responsible for design, construction, maintenance, and inspection on a variety of highway, transit, bicycle, and pedestrian projects, having experience from the consultant’s side and as project engineer for the owner. His experience includes site surveys, corridor alignment layout studies and designs, right of way layout and property research, drainage studies and design, utility mapping and coordination, inter-agency coordination, and management of bridge inspection condition reporting. He has served as a team teacher for The Pennsylvania State University Beaver Campus Civil PE review course concentrating on transportation, construction management, and open channel flow. He has authored Transportation Depth Reference Manual for the Civil PE Exam, Transportation Depth Six-Minute Problems for the PE Civil Exam, Flashcards for Civil PE exam preparation, and was an advisor for on-line PE Transportation Exam Review Forum. He has taught Transportation Engineering courses at University of Pittsburgh and continues as a participant on the Senior Design Project Review panel for the department of Civil and Environmental Engineering.
